substance Matters: The Foundation of Longevity

The lifespan and trustworthiness of the cable connector commence at by far the most fundamental degree: the material It truly is produced from. The choice of material dictates its resistance to environmental stressors, its structural integrity over time, and eventually, how commonly it will need alternative.

The Power of higher-toughness Aluminum: although many metals are Employed in connector manufacturing, significant-power aluminum alloys supply compelling strengths in precise demanding apps. Notably, their inherent resistance to corrosion is a substantial variable. In environments characterised by significant humidity, salinity (coastal or maritime programs), or publicity to industrial chemical substances, connectors made from inferior components can speedily succumb to rust and degradation. This corrosion not merely compromises the Actual physical structure and also degrades electrical overall performance, resulting in likely failures and required substitution. large-top quality aluminum alloys, having said that, kind a protecting oxide layer, enabling them to face up to these severe disorders for prolonged durations. This tends to make them extremely effectively-fitted to extended-phrase outdoor installations, renewable Vitality infrastructure, and challenging industrial settings where longevity is paramount.

Structural security and getting old: over and above corrosion, the inherent steadiness of the selected materials performs a crucial purpose in combating structural getting old. Connectors are subjected to mechanical stress for the duration of installation (crimping) and throughout their operational lifetime on account of vibration, temperature fluctuations, and Actual physical dealing with. superior-good quality products, engineered for security, resist deformation, micro-fractures, and embrittlement eventually. This ensures the connector maintains its structural integrity and clamping drive, preventing intermittent connections or comprehensive failures that necessitate premature replacement.

Comparative Lifespan Analysis: when put next to some commonly utilized supplies like primary steel or selected grades of brass, thoroughly picked and addressed higher-power aluminum alloys can supply exceptional longevity, significantly in corrosive environments. when copper is a wonderful conductor usually desired (several hunt for a responsible Copper connector supplier for this reason), specialized aluminum alloys can offer a far better equilibrium of sturdiness, pounds, and corrosion resistance for specific structural and environmental troubles. the choice is not about conductivity by itself, but the holistic efficiency above your complete lifecycle. picking products specifically for their endurance traits demonstrates a further determination to lowering the substitute cycle, and that is inherently more sustainable. a lot less Regular substitute usually means much less mining, refining, and processing of raw materials over the operational lifespan of the products or installation.

Engineered for Endurance: The Role of Structural layout

materials selection lays the groundwork, but advanced structural style transforms probable longevity into reliable overall performance. The way a connector is engineered instantly impacts its capability to type and preserve a protected, low-resistance link, reducing the need for upkeep and substitute.

Precision Interfaces (DIN expectations): Adherence to proven expectations, which include DIN seventy four for selected connector varieties, signifies a commitment to precision engineering. These expectations dictate important dimensions and tolerances for that connector's interface. A exactly manufactured interface assures a snug, safe suit While using the corresponding terminal or conductor. This higher degree of suit minimizes the likely for micro-actions attributable to vibration or thermal cycling, which may lead to loosening, improved Get in touch with resistance, warmth generation (hot spots), and possibly risky electrical arcing. A connection that stays tight calls for significantly less frequent inspection and eliminates failures because of very poor mechanical match, therefore extending its helpful everyday living and lowering associated servicing labor.

Mechanically Robust Crimping Zones: The crimp space is the place the connector bodily joins the cable conductor. the look of this zone is critical for prolonged-expression reliability. Connectors engineered with large mechanical toughness while in the crimping barrel make sure a sound, gas-limited link when properly crimped. This sturdy layout withstands the numerous forces applied during installation with out cracking or deforming excessively. much more importantly, it maintains constant force on the conductor strands as time passes, blocking strand breakage, pull-out, or the ingress of moisture and contaminants that could degrade the connection. A strong, reputable crimp is basic to protecting against electrical failures and the following have to have for connector alternative.

Adaptability and Waste Reduction: Connectors made with wide adaptability for many cable sizes or kinds within a specified selection supply Yet another refined sustainability edge. employing a connector that can reliably accommodate somewhat unique conductor diameters or insulation thicknesses (in just its rated ability) lowers the probability of working with an incorrectly sized component, which can result in bad connections or squandered parts. What's more, it simplifies stock management for large assignments, lessening the quantity of SKUs desired and reducing potential obsolescence or squander resulting from specification variations.

Extending the Lifecycle: a protracted-Term standpoint on cost savings

The accurate worth of a strong connector emerges when viewed with the lens of its overall lifecycle. concentrating exclusively about the upfront obtain price tag ignores the sizeable downstream charges related to frequent replacements.

Comparing Replacement Cycles: take into consideration a normal industrial application. Standard, reduce-quality connectors might involve inspection and possible substitute each individual number of years, or much more regularly in severe environments. In contrast, a high-toughness connector, constructed with outstanding components and style, could realistically very last noticeably longer, Probably matching the lifespan of your tools alone. Quantifying this variation – evaluating the normal alternative cycle of normal connectors versus the extended lifespan of premium kinds – reveals a persuasive economic argument.

Cumulative Cost price savings (further than the portion): Each individual replacement occasion incurs costs considerably exceeding the price of the connector alone. These involve:

oLabor: specialists' time for diagnostics, removing, and set up.

oDowntime: misplaced output or operational functionality though repairs are made.

oLogistics: Transportation fees For brand new parts and perhaps for staff.

oMaterials: The cost of the substitute connector and any linked consumables.

When multiplied about hundreds or Countless relationship details in a considerable facility or challenge, and recurring over numerous alternative cycles averted, the cumulative discounts become substantial. This overall price of possession (TCO) viewpoint Evidently favors tough elements.

decreasing Rework and job Delays: In significant engineering or building initiatives, connector failures through commissioning or early Procedure can lead to pricey rework and substantial delays. making use of connectors known for their trustworthiness within the outset minimizes this chance. picture the influence on a renewable Vitality farm or possibly a producing plant rollout if dozens of connections are unsuccessful prematurely – the troubleshooting hard work and plan disruption can dwarf the Original cost difference of utilizing higher-excellent elements. Durability translates instantly into project certainty and reliability.

Resource Conservation: far more Than Just steel

The environmental benefits of durable connectors lengthen further than simply applying significantly less Uncooked material over time. cutting down the replacement frequency triggers a optimistic cascade effect across a number of useful resource streams.

decreased production Footprint: each connector produced needs Strength for extraction, processing, production, and ending. much less replacements indicate appreciably fewer cumulative Strength usage and less related emissions (greenhouse gases, pollutants) from your production approach around the system's life span. Furthermore, it usually means fewer scrap metal generated in the course of output and disposal.

Minimized Packaging squander: Connectors are generally packaged for cover and identification. when needed, packaging contributes to waste streams. Halving the quantity of replacements required right halves the connected packaging waste (cardboard, plastic) generated over the operational period of time.

decreased Transportation Emissions: less substitution cycles immediately translate into fewer transportation runs required to deliver new parts to site, Primarily essential for large-scale industrial assignments or geographically dispersed infrastructure. This reduction in logistics activity lowers the overall carbon footprint associated with upkeep and upkeep.

Increased Energy effectiveness: Poor or degrading connections exhibit increased electrical resistance. This resistance results in Electrical power decline in the shape of heat (I²R losses) and can cause voltage drops, most likely affecting equipment effectiveness. steady, minimal-resistance connections maintained over very long intervals because of durable connectors lead to General procedure Vitality efficiency, minimizing operational Strength squander.
